The University of Engineering and Technology (UET), Peshawar, has officially announced the ETEA Computer-Based Entrance Test (CBT) 2025 for admissions to B.Sc. Engineering and B.Architecture programs. This test is a mandatory requirement for admission to all public and private sector engineering universities/colleges situated in the geographical territory of Khyber Pakhtunkhwa. Supervised by the Educational Testing and Evaluation Agency (ETEA), the test ensures a centralized and transparent admission process.

Each year, thousands of students appear in this competitive test to secure their spot in top engineering disciplines. UET Peshawar has made it easier for students to apply through an online registration system. With no negative marking, a well-balanced syllabus, and multiple testing sessions, the ETEA Entry Test remains one of the most important academic milestones for students seeking engineering and architecture careers in KPK.

Test Schedules

TEST-I

  • Online Registration Starts: 30-06-2025
  • Last Date for Registration: 13-07-2025
  • Test Dates: 19th July – 25th July, 2025

TEST-II

  • Online Registration Starts: 20-07-2025
  • Last Date for Registration: 31-07-2025
  • Test Dates: 9th August – 12th August, 2025

UET Peshawar Entry Test Registration Online

To apply for the UET Peshawar Entry Test 2025, candidates must visit the official ETEA website (https://etea.edu.pk). The registration process involves creating an account, filling in the application form, uploading required documents, and submitting a test fee of Rs. 1000/- per test (non-refundable). Candidates can register separately for both test sessions (Test-I and Test-II) if desired. Each test attempt allows students to improve their merit standing based on the best score obtained.

UETP Entry Test ETEA Online Registration

Applicants must carefully select their test center and subject group during registration. After submitting the form, students should regularly check the ETEA portal for updates on roll number slips and test-related announcements. Intermediate Part-II result awaiting candidates are also eligible to apply.

Entry Test ETEA Roll No Slip 2025

Once the registration is complete, ETEA will issue the Roll Number Slips approximately one week before the test date. These slips will contain important details including the test center, date, time, and candidate’s photo and roll number. Candidates are required to download and print the roll number slip from the ETEA website. It is mandatory to bring the printed slip and a valid CNIC/B-form to the test center. ETEA conducts the test in a computer-based format in multiple cities including Peshawar, Mardan, Swat, Abbottabad, D.I. Khan, and Malakand. Test takers must arrive on time and follow all instructions mentioned on the roll number slip.

Test Format

For Intermediate (Pre-Engineering / Computer Science / Pre-Medical with Additional Maths / A-Level / DAE / B-Tech)

  • Total MCQs: 100
  • Physics: 40
  • Mathematics: 35
  • English: 15
  • Chemistry/Computer Science: 10

For Intermediate (Pre-Medical Only)

  • Total MCQs: 65
  • Physics: 40
  • English: 15
  • Chemistry: 10

Eligibility Criteria

FSc (Intermediate) Candidates:

  • Passed Pre-Engineering / Pre-Medical / Computer Science / Pre-Medical with Additional Mathematics.
  • Must have obtained at least 60% unadjusted marks.
  • Must have combination of Physics, Mathematics & Chemistry or Computer Science.
  • DAE/B-Tech Candidates: Passed 3-year Diploma of Associate Engineer or B-Tech with at least 60% unadjusted marks.
  • Result Awaiting Candidates: Intermediate Part-II (FSc) result awaiting candidates are eligible to apply.

How to Apply

  • Apply online at: https://etea.edu.pk
  • Fee: Rs. 1000/- per test (Non-refundable)
  • Apply separately for each test.
  • Roll Number Slips will be issued one week before the test.
  • Candidates must submit an admission form later, as per UET Peshawar’s admission schedule.

FAQs

Q1. Who is eligible to apply for UET Peshawar Entry Test 2025?

Candidates who have passed Intermediate (Pre-Engineering / Pre-Medical with Additional Maths / Computer Science) with at least 60% unadjusted marks or equivalent qualifications (DAE, B-Tech) are eligible. Result-awaiting students can also apply.

Q2. How many tests can a candidate appear in?

Candidates can appear in both Test-I and Test-II, and the best score will be considered for admission.

Q3. What is the test pattern?

For engineering candidates: 100 MCQs (Physics: 40, Math: 35, English: 15, Chemistry/Computer Science: 10).

For Pre-Medical: 65 MCQs (Physics: 40, English: 15, Chemistry: 10). No negative marking applies.

Q4. What is the registration fee and how to pay?

The registration fee is Rs. 1000 per test, payable online during the registration process via ETEA’s portal.

Q5. When will the results be announced?

Results will be announced shortly after the tests. Candidates must apply separately for UET admission through the official UET Peshawar admission portal.
